Sub prime litigation: Advising a major investment bank in relation to disputes with a large number of Australian investors arising from the fall in value of CDOs associated with the sub-prime fallout in the United States.  In particular, we are providing advice on recovery under the client's professional indemnity, directors' and officers' and investment management insurance policies in Australia and in the United States.

Department of DefenceF-111 Deseal/Reseal Class Actions: This matter involved the defence of two class actions commenced under the class action provisions of the Queensland Uniform Civil Procedure Rules.  We successfully challenged the actions on a number of grounds, including non-compliance with PIPA, and both actions were discontinued.

ACT Insurance Authority - Canberra bushfires: Advising the captive insurer of the ACT Government in respect of insurance and reinsurance claims associated with property losses following the Canberra bushfires.  This involved the review of complex industrial special risks and business interruption insurance and reinsurance covering property worth $750 million.

Queensland Water Commission, Department of Natural Resources and Water, Port of Townsville, Department of Transport, Department of Main Roads and SEQ Water: Advising these government bodies on legal liability and risk management issues and particularly the liability of public authority reforms introduced by the Civil Liability Act 2003.

Airport Link and Northern Busway and Tugun Bypass: Advising the State of Queensland on insurance and liability risk transfer issues associated with the joint procurement of the Airport Link and Northern Busway Infrastructure Projects and the Tugun Bypass Project.

Corporate D&O reviews: Advising a number of publicly listed companies and their Boards in relation to director’s insurance and indemnity issues,  including Queensland Investment Corporation, Queensland Rail,  Babcock and Brown, Billabong International Limited, GWA International Limited, GPT Group and RACQ

D&O and M&A transactions: Advising on directors’ insurance and indemnity issues arising from private equity and M&A transactions, including advice in relation to the private equity transactions involving the Colorado Group Limited and Mincom Limited, the merger between Smorgon Group Limited and OneSteel Limited and the recent acquisitions of Sunshine Gas Limited by Queensland Gas Limited and then its subsequent acquisition by BG Group Plc.
